Setting the time program for central heating
The time program for central heating is
made up of time phases. One time
phase from 6:00 to 22:00 h for every
day of the week is set at the factory.
You can set the time program individ-
ually, to be the same for every day of
the week or different:
You can select up to 4 time phases per
day for standard heating mode. Set the
start and end points for each time
phase. Between these time phases,
the rooms are heated with the reduced
room temperature (see chapter "Set-
ting the room temperature for reduced
heating mode").
When setting, bear in mind that your
heating system requires some time to
heat the rooms to the required tem-
perature.
In the extended menu, you can scan
the current time program under "Infor-
mation" (see chapter "Scanning infor-
mation", "Heating circuit ..." group).
Extended menu:
1.
2. "Heating"
3. Select the heating circuit if necessary.
4. "Heating time program"
5. Select part of the week or a day.
6.
Select the time phase !, ?, § or
$
.
7. Set the start and end points for the
relevant time phase.
8. Press to exit the menu.
Note
If you want to terminate a time phase
setting process prematurely, keep
pressing until the required display
appears.
